    Every time I think about their chicken tenders and pancakes, my mouth starts salivating. This family run business has it all, great service, excellent food and reasonable prices. They have the most moist chicken tenders (with different sauce dips), smacking Mac and cheese and oh so fluffy pancakes with homemade sauce. I am so happy to see their cart popping up at the local events now. If you're looking for them to cater your events, you can't go wrong with the perfectly savory fried and seasoned tenders and balance it out with the buttery pancakes. Next time you see their elegant cart, don't pass it up because they're serving up the best comfort food.

    Baby Cafe does not disappoint when it comes to its Hainan chicken. My wife and I dropped by for…read morelunch at 12:30 p.m. on a Saturday afternoon with some friends and we were able to immediately get seated at a table. Between the two of us, we ordered a whole Hainan chicken -- knowing that we'd have enough leftovers for dinner later that evening, as well as a baked fish fillet over rice. Like all baked entrees, you should expect to wait around 20 minutes or so for the dish to be prepared. If you anticipate being hungry during the extended wait, I'd recommend ordering some snacks as well, like popcorn chicken or some curry fish balls. The baked fish fillet here is absolutely delicious. If you enjoy Korean corn cheese, this dish feels like corn cheese over rice, with a perfectly crispy fish filet on top, smothered with a white cream sauce. This dish is incredibly rich and each bite feels like a warm hug. You'll definitely be in the mood for a nap after finishing this dish. The Hainan chicken here is probably some of the best in the Bay. The chicken skin has the gelatinous texture of well-prepared Hainan chicken, and the chicken itself is incredibly moist and tender. The chickens they serve up are absolutely massive and a whole chicken should comfortably feed a family of four. The ginger scallion sauce on the side could use a touch of salt, but that's just my personal preference for things to be a tad saltier. Overall, if you're craving Hong Kong diner food, Baby Cafe is a great option in this part of town. I would definitely stop by again for lunch.

    2Oi is an home kitchen that opened 2 years ago in Argyle Palms Apartments. Initially I didn't know…read morehow to order. Lately, I saw instructions posted on their website on Yelp. I called to place order. Got a recording. Got a return call confirming my order. Found it's better to text with C6 or F7 unless one can speak Vietnamese. Main associate lacks English proficiency. Much easier for her to get "code" Place was an easy find. Street parking slightly difficult. Unknown if parking in their lot is permissible. Went towards big building on the right . Found unit with "Taste of Asia" brochure on window. Just before the gate. Bingo! Stood in front of open door until Vietnamese lady came out with my order. $21 cash. Unknown if Zelle has tax added to it. Tipped a little. Lady hesitated to give change. Offerings (Vietnamese): street food, drinks, coffee. Sips: Cafe Muoi Bien (sea salt foam Vietnamese coffee, 7)-Viet coffee, sea salt foam, condensed milk. -coffee didn't look full. No doubt foam on top shrank/mixed into coffee. -bold coffee with alternating sweet & salty tastes depending on sipping foam or condensed milk. Bites: Banh Trang Cuon (Vietnamese Special roll, 14). There's also a salad version with same ingredients & no wrapping. -dipping sauce had sweet & savory notes. -rice roll had dominant theme of beef jerky. The surrounding nuanced taste was a symphonic medley of carrots, quarter sectioned boiled eggs, coriander, green mango, dried shrimp, fried onions, peanuts & green mangos, 5 stars Worthy! Quality: freshly premade. Quantiy: ample enough for a meal.
